Before the Frost was the only episode in this excellent series that I found a bit of a slog, after a baffling, macabre and unique opening we get pretty much eighty minutes of slow drama, then a fantastic, gripping last ten minutes. After the brilliance of The Dogs of Riga, this one seems slow and almost overly grim. Lindsay Duncan is excellent as Monica, a hugely talented actress, who lit up the screen alongside Branagh. Nice to finally see Kurt enjoy some quality time with his daughter, and engage with her.

The story is very clever and fascinating, I just find the delivery a little pedestrian, at times it felt overly sombre. Still very good, just a little flat in comparison to other episodes. As for his ringtone!! Who keeps the same one for 4 years?
